How much is excise tax on a used car in Oklahoma?
The excise tax is 3 ¼ percent of the value of a new vehicle. For a used vehicle, the excise tax is $20 on the first $1,500 and 3 ¼ percent thereafter. The value of a vehicle is its actual sales price. The annual registration fee for non-commercial vehicles ranges from $15 to $85 depending on the age of the vehicle.

How much will my tag and tax be in Oklahoma?
New vehicle: 3.25 percent of purchase price. Used vehicle: $20 up to a value of $1,500, plus 3.25 percent on the remainder value. All terrain vehicle: 4.5 percent of the purchase price, minimum $5.

How is the excise tax calculated in Oklahoma?
How to Calculate Oklahoma Car Tax. The excise tax for new cars is 3.25%, and for used cars, the tax is $20.00 for the first $1500.00 and 3.25% on the remainder of the sale price.
